We are working with a well-established and reputable steel construction company seeking an experienced HSQE Manager to support both office operations and live project sites. This is a key role focused on driving high standards across Health, Safety, Quality, and Environmental compliance within a fast-paced project environment.
The Role
- Lead and manage all Health, Safety, Quality, and Environmental activities across the business
- Ensure compliance with current legislation, company procedures, and industry standards
- Conduct site inspections, audits, and risk assessments across live projects
- Review and support the preparation of RAMS (Risk Assessments & Method Statements)
- Complete and manage environmental documentation, ensuring compliance with environmental standards and project requirements
- Investigate incidents, identify root causes, and implement corrective actions
- Promote a strong health & safety culture across both site and office teams
- Maintain and improve HSQE systems, policies, and procedures
- Support project teams with best practice and continuous improvement initiatives
- Liaise with clients, stakeholders, and regulatory bodies as required
About You
- Proven experience in a HSQE role within construction or structural steel (essential)
- Strong working knowledge of health & safety and environmental legislation
- Experience producing and managing environmental documentation (essential)
- Experience carrying out site audits, inspections, and incident investigations
- Confident working across both office and site environments
- Excellent communication skills with the ability to influence and engage teams
- Proactive, organised, and able to manage multiple priorities

How to prepare for a job interview at The Highfield Company
✨Know Your HSQE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your health, safety, quality, and environmental legislation. Be ready to discuss specific examples from your past roles where you've successfully implemented these standards. This shows you're not just familiar with the theory but can apply it in real-world situations.
✨Showcase Your Site Experience
Since this role involves regular site visits, be prepared to talk about your experience conducting site inspections and audits. Share any challenges you've faced on-site and how you overcame them. This will demonstrate your hands-on approach and problem-solving skills.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ect questions that ask how you'd handle specific HSQE scenarios. Think of a few examples where you've had to investigate incidents or implement corrective actions.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ers clearly.
✨Engage with Your Interviewers
Don't forget that interviews are a two-way street! Prepare some thoughtful questions about the company's HSQE culture and their expectations for the role. This not only shows your interest but also helps you gauge if the company is the right fit for you.
